[Steve Myers] Do you feel powerful in your faith? The Apostle Paul dealt with this a
little bit in 1 Corinthians probably because in Corinth there were times that, you know,
people thought they could do everything, and then there were others that felt well, maybe
my faith is lacking. So Paul gave a little bit of a perspective in 1 Corinthians 1:18.
Notice he said this, "The message of the cross is foolishness to those who are perishing,
but to us who are being saved it is the power of God."
So as God begins to open our minds to His truth and His love and His way and His plan,
Paul says there's a power in that, that we can have the power to have a changed life,
a changed perspective, a different viewpoint that's a spiritual viewpoint. Now as you read
that and sometimes I think as we consider our faith we have a tendency to think that
we've got to work this up, and we've got to be powerful. And oftentimes it leaves us feeling
like, boy am I lacking. I don't feel powerful. Actually I feel pretty weak overall. Yet,
we have misplaced faith I think when it comes to that, and Paul dealt with that just a little
bit later in chapter 2. Here's what he says down in verse 5, he says that your faith should
not be in the wisdom of men, but in the power of God (1 Corinthians 2:5).
Now you see that changes everything doesn't it? That my trust, my faith, my confidence,
the assurance that I have isn't something I have to work up and somehow be this powerful
person. Yes, I'm working and I'm striving for that, but you know he says it's in the
power of God.
So when I feel like I'm not very powerful, when I'm feeling like I don't measure up,
when I'm feelingĀ a lack of confidence, maybe a lack of trust, here's a good time to step
back and realize my faith should be in the power of God. So, if you feel that way, what
can we do?
Well, I can read a story in the Bible about God's power. What has God done? What has He
done for others? Boy, the Bible is filled with stories of individuals where God did
miraculous things, amazing things, phenomenal things for people, and He did it in tremendous
ways. We can read those stories. Now is that something then we can step back and say, wow,
I can have a strength of character, a strength of confidence because God does what He says
He's going to do. God promised us in that message that Paul talked about in chapter
1. He promised in that message that He's never going to leave us. He's never going to forsake
us. He promised He'll always be with us. Can I have trust in that? Can I have faith in
that? Can I feel powerful in the fact that God will do what He says He will do? Absolutely
we can.
And so next time you're feeling maybe just a lack of confidence, lack of power, remember
1 Corinthians. Put your power and your faith in God.
